Atiku Abubakar, the Peoples Democratic Party’s nominee for president in the 2023 presidential election, has arrived in Kogi state for the party’s massive rally ahead of this Saturday’s governorship election.

The former vice president of the nation, Atiku, announced his visit on his official X Twitter and stated that he was in Kogi to back Dino Melaye, the party’s candidate for governor.

“My delegation and the @OfficialPDPNig are live at Sen. Tunde Ogbeha’s residence for Sen. Dino Melaye’s grand-rally, the PDP’s candidate for governorship in Saturday’s election,” Atiku wrote in a post.

The Independent National Electoral Commission, or INEC, will hold the off-cycle governorship elections in the states of Bayelsa, Imo, and Kogi on Saturday.

Melaye, the PDP contender in the Kogi state governorship election, is considered one of the favorites to win the position of governor.

According to Naija News, the Labour Party disbanded and announced its endorsement of PDP governor candidate Dino Melaye. The development dealt a severe blow to Ahmed Ododo, the candidate of the ruling All Progressives Congress (APC), and his ambitions.

Disagreements have already been reported inside the ruling party’s ranks, with disgruntled party members endorsing African Democratic Congress (ADC) candidate Leke Abejide and accusing Governor Yahaya Bello of forcing his candidate on the organization.
